Alexandra Jane Davies: A Weaver of Welsh Landscapes and Fairy Worlds

Born into a lineage steeped in artistic legacy, Alexandra Jane Davies’s journey as an artist is one of remarkable evolution, blending traditional techniques with a deeply personal vision. Her work, primarily focused on evocative seascapes, vibrant Welsh landscapes, and whimsical fairy woodlands, reflects not only her innate talent but also the rich cultural heritage she draws upon – a lineage that includes notable figures like Jane Cavendish, a poet and playwright who defied societal expectations during the tumultuous years of the English Civil War.

Davies’s early life was shaped by a strong connection to nature and a burgeoning artistic sensibility. Initially pursuing pottery, she found herself drawn to the versatility of watercolor, recognizing its ability to capture both the grand scale of the natural world and the delicate intricacies of detail. This transition wasn't merely a shift in medium; it represented a deeper commitment to visual storytelling – a desire to translate her observations and emotions onto paper with an unparalleled level of precision and feeling. Her training at Bennington College and subsequent studies at the School for American Crafts provided a solid foundation, but it was her experiences teaching art and engaging with diverse communities that truly shaped her approach.

The Influence of Welsh Heritage and Artistic Ancestry

Davies’s work is inextricably linked to her Welsh roots. The rugged coastlines, rolling hills, and ancient forests of Wales provide the backdrop for many of her most celebrated paintings. She possesses a keen eye for detail, meticulously rendering the textures of weathered stone, the shifting patterns of light on water, and the dappled shadows beneath ancient trees. This dedication to realism is often tempered by an almost dreamlike quality, as if she’s capturing not just what *is* but also what *feels* – the spirit of a place.

Technique and Style: A Delicate Balance

Davies’s technique is characterized by a remarkable balance between precision and spontaneity. She employs layered washes of watercolor to build up depth and atmosphere, carefully controlling the flow of pigment to achieve subtle gradations of color and tone. Her use of detail is meticulous, yet never overwhelming – she knows when to let the eye wander and allow the overall composition to speak for itself.

Her style can be described as a blend of realism and impressionism. While her paintings are undeniably grounded in observation, they also possess an ethereal quality that transcends mere representation. She skillfully utilizes techniques such as dry brushing and glazing to create textures and effects that evoke the feeling of wind-swept landscapes, shimmering water, and dappled sunlight.
